/*
//-----------------------------------------------------------------------------------//
//  PageUp AG
//-----------------------------------------------------------------------------------//
//  styles.css
//
//  CSS
//-----------------------------------------------------------------------------------//
*/

*.whitetextsmall {
 font-family: arial, helvetica, verdana, sans-serif;
 font-size: 10px;
 color: #ffffff;
} 

*.blacktext {
 font-family: arial, helvetica, verdana, sans-serif;
 font-size: 12px;
 color: #000000;
} 

*.bwhitetext {
 font-family: arial, helvetica, verdana, sans-serif;
 font-weight: bold;
 font-size: 12px;
 color: #ffffff;
}

*.bbluetext {
 font-family: arial, helvetica, verdana, sans-serif;
 font-weight: bold;
 font-size: 12px;
 color: #000000;
}

*.middletext {
 font-family: arial, helvetica, verdana, sans-serif;
 font-weight: bold;
 font-size: 14px;
}

*.bigtext {
 font-family: arial, helvetica, verdana, sans-serif;
 font-weight: bold;
 font-size: 16px;
}

*.text {
 font-family: arial, helvetica, verdana, sans-serif;
 font-size: 12px;
 color: #516179;
}

*.btextwhite {
 font-family: arial, helvetica, verdana, sans-serif;
 font-size: 12px;
 color: #ffffff;
 font-weight: bold;
}

*.btextdarkblue {
 font-family: arial, helvetica, verdana, sans-serif;
 font-size: 13px;
 color: #000000;
 font-weight: bold;
}

*.btext {
 font-family: arial, helvetica, verdana, sans-serif;
 font-weight: bold;
 font-size: 12px;
}

*.mikrotext {
 font-family: arial, helvetica, verdana, sans-serif;;
 font-size: 9px;
}

/*Border Top, Bottom, Left*/
*.border1pxtbrln {
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;

 border-right-width:1px;
 border-right-color:#000000;
 border-right-style:solid;
 
 border-left-width:1px;
 border-left-color:#000000;
 border-left-style:solid;
 
 color:#000000; 
 background-color:#516179;
}

*.border1pxtbrls {
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;

 border-right-width:1px;
 border-right-color:#000000;
 border-right-style:solid;
 
 border-left-width:1px;
 border-left-color:#000000;
 border-left-style:solid;
 
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}

/*Border Top, Bottom, Left*/
*.border1pxtbrn {
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;

 border-right-width:1px;
 border-right-color:#000000;
 border-right-style:solid;
 
 color:#000000; 
 background-color:#516179;
}

*.border1pxtbrs {
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;

 border-right-width:1px;
 border-right-color:#000000;
 border-right-style:solid;
 
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}

/*Border Right, Bottom*/
*.border1pxbrn {
 border-right-width:1px;
 border-right-color:#8695AD;
 border-right-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 color:#000000; 
 background-color:#516179;}

*.border1pxbrs {
 border-right-width:1px;
 border-right-color:#8695AD;
 border-right-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}

/*Border Top, Bottom*/
*.border1pxtbn {
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 color:#000000; 
 background-color:#516179;}
}

*.border1pxtbs {
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
 
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}

/*Border Bottom*/

*.border1pxhbbn {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
  
 color:#000000; 
 background-color:#516179;}
}

*.border1pxhbbs {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
  
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}

*.border1pxhbb {
  border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 
 cursor:pointer
}

*.border1pxhbbt {
  
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}


/*Border Bottom, Top*/

*.border1pxtbn {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
  
 color:#000000; 
 background-color:#516179;
}

*.border1pxtbs {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
  
 color:#000000; 
 background-color:#8695AD; 
 cursor:pointer
}

/*Border Bottom, Top*/

*.border1pxhbtb {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
  
 background-color:#8695AD
}

*.border1pxdbtb {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
 
 border-top-width:1px;
 border-top-color:#000000;
 border-top-style:solid;
  
 background-color:#516179
}

*.border1pxb {
 border-bottom-width:1px;
 border-bottom-color:#000000;
 border-bottom-style:solid;
   
 background-color:#8695AD
}

a.linktop:hover {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
  font-size: 12px;
 font-weight: bold;
 color: #ffffff;
 
}

a.linktop:link {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
  font-size: 12px;
 font-weight: bold;
 color: #ffffff;
}

a.linktop:active {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
  font-size: 12px;
 font-weight: bold;
 color: #ffffff;
}

a.linktop:visited {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
  font-size: 12px;
 font-weight: bold;
 color: #ffffff;
}

a.linkleft:visited:hover {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#ffffff;
}

a.linkleft:hover {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#ffffff;
}

a.linkleft:link {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#000000;
}

a.linkleft:active {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#ffffff;
}

a.linkleft:visited {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#000000;
}


a.linkleft:visited:hover {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#ffffff;
}

a.linkmain:hover {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#516179;
}

a.linkmain:link {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: yes;
 font-size: 12px;
 color: #516179;
}

a.linkmain:active {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
 font-size: 12px;
 color: #516179;
}

a.linkmain:visited {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: yes;
 font-size: 12px;
 color: #516179;
}

a.linkmain:visited:hover {
 font-family: arial, helvetica, verdana, sans-serif;
 text-decoration: none;
  font-size: 12px;

 color: #516179;
}

